sleep deprivation is no joke, as it interferes with all of our activities and mental acuity, and our attitudes towards others. how? we are out of focus and unaware of our own behaviors for a period because our sleep wasn't sufficient to restore our abilities and health.
that is how important sleep is.
perhaps if you found the thing that helps you get ready for restful sleep, AND DO IT, each night could be a blessing.
some people use warm milk, it releases trytophan (sp), which aides sleep, some use chamomile tea, or a nightime tea (a herbal w/o caffeine), cutting off caffeine at noon each day and cutting out soft drinks with caffeine, having a warm bath or shower at the same time each evening, and reading a magazine or a book unrelated to school, for relaxation till lights out, or writing or drawing in a journal....and listening to soft music before bed, or books on tape ... these things do work if you work them.
